China Used Cooking Oil Market Insight



• China represents one of the world's largest Used Cooking Oil markets, generating an estimated 4.5–5.5 million tons of UCO annually in 2025, driven by its extensive foodservice industry and urban population exceeding 940 million people. Cities such as Beijing, Shanghai, Guangzhou, Shenzhen, Chengdu, and Chongqing serve as major UCO generation hubs due to their dense restaurant networks and expanding food delivery ecosystems. Despite the scale of generation, formal collection systems capture approximately 55–65 percent of recoverable volumes, leaving substantial room for further market development.

The country's historical "gutter oil" incidents fundamentally altered regulatory priorities. As a result, authorities have implemented increasingly stringent traceability requirements to prevent illegally recycled oils from re-entering the food chain. This unique market characteristic has accelerated investment in licensed collection systems and enhanced oversight across the value chain.
• Chinese refiners and aviation stakeholders are increasingly evaluating waste-derived feedstocks to support decarbonization objectives. Companies such as Sinopec, Longyan Zhuoyue Group, Zhejiang Jiaao Enprotech, and China National Aviation Fuel Group are strengthening their positions within renewable diesel and SAF supply chains, creating long-term demand momentum for certified UCO.

PESTLE Analysis


• China's policy environment increasingly favors resource efficiency and circular economy development. Agencies including the National Development and Reform Commission NDRC, the Ministry of Ecology and Environment MEE, and local municipal governments continue promoting waste utilization initiatives. The country's commitment to achieving carbon neutrality by 2060 has strengthened interest in advanced biofuels derived from waste feedstocks.
• UCO prices in China ranged between CNY 7,200 and CNY 9,500 per ton during 2025, influenced by export demand, domestic processing capacity, and certification requirements. Coastal provinces generally exhibit stronger pricing due to proximity to export infrastructure and industrial demand centers. Collection and transportation expenses account for approximately 12–18 percent of total supply chain costs.
• China's restaurant industry generated revenues exceeding CNY 5 trillion in 2025, supporting substantial UCO generation potential. Food delivery platforms such as Meituan and Ele.me have indirectly expanded commercial cooking activity across urban areas. However, consumer awareness regarding household UCO recycling remains limited, with formal participation rates estimated at below 15 percent nationwide.
• Leading processors are investing heavily in digital traceability systems, automated pre-treatment facilities, and advanced conversion technologies. Technological improvements have enhanced processing efficiency by approximately 18–22 percent since 2023, particularly among export-oriented operators targeting international sustainability markets.
• China maintains strict regulatory controls governing the collection, transportation, and utilization of waste cooking oils. Authorities continue intensifying enforcement actions against illegal reuse practices. Violations involving the unauthorized handling of gutter oil may result in significant financial penalties and criminal prosecution.
• The diversion of UCO toward renewable fuel production supports national emissions reduction objectives. UCO-derived biofuels can achieve lifecycle greenhouse gas reductions of approximately 75–90 percent compared with conventional petroleum fuels, strengthening their environmental value proposition.

Recent Industry Developments


Sinopec advanced SAF initiatives utilizing waste-based feedstocks during 2025
Sinopec continued expanding renewable aviation fuel activities through projects designed to support China's emerging SAF market, increasing interest in large-scale UCO procurement.
Longyan Zhuoyue strengthened export-oriented UCO processing operations during 2024
The company expanded its position within international waste-based biofuel supply chains by enhancing certified processing capabilities and increasing export volumes.
Municipal authorities intensified gutter oil enforcement campaigns during 2025
Cities including Shanghai and Shenzhen strengthened inspections targeting illegal collection activities, supporting the transition toward more transparent and regulated supply systems.

Regulatory Landscape


• China's UCO market is governed by a combination of food safety regulations, environmental policies, and waste management requirements administered by agencies including the NDRC, MEE, State Administration for Market Regulation SAMR, and local governments.
• The country's regulatory approach differs significantly from many international markets because of its strong emphasis on preventing gutter oil re-entry into food supply chains. Licensed collection, transportation permits, and documentation requirements have therefore become central components of market operations. As renewable fuel applications expand, sustainability verification practices are also gaining importance.

Value Creation Hotspots Across the Supply Chain


• Major metropolitan regions including Shanghai, Beijing, Guangzhou, Shenzhen, and Chengdu provide attractive collection opportunities due to their concentration of restaurants, hotels, and institutional kitchens. Route optimization within these cities can improve profitability by approximately 15–20 percent.
• Large aggregators capable of consolidating fragmented commercial volumes benefit from lower processing costs and enhanced supply reliability, particularly in economically developed eastern provinces.
• Facilities equipped with advanced quality control and documentation systems are better positioned to access export markets and supply high-value downstream applications.
• As Chinese energy companies increase investments in renewable diesel and SAF, processors supplying qualified feedstocks are likely to experience stronger demand conditions.
• Export-focused operators serving markets with strict sustainability standards can achieve significant pricing advantages compared with purely domestic channels.

Import Dependency Analysis


• China remains predominantly supported by domestic UCO generation due to the sheer scale of its foodservice sector. Internal production is estimated to satisfy more than 85 percent of national processing requirements, limiting reliance on imported feedstocks.
• However, regional imbalances exist between coastal industrial demand centers and inland supply areas. As renewable fuel production expands, competition for high-quality certified UCO may intensify, increasing the importance of efficient domestic collection systems. China also plays a notable role within international UCO trade flows through exports of processed waste-based feedstocks destined for overseas renewable fuel markets.

Segment Analysis


By Source
Food Service dominates China's UCO market, accounting for approximately 75–80 percent of total recoverable volumes, reflecting the country's extensive restaurant and food delivery ecosystem. Food Processing contributes around 12–15 percent, supported by China's large packaged food manufacturing industry. Household sources account for approximately 5–8 percent, constrained by relatively low participation in formal recycling programs. Other institutional sources represent the remaining market share.
By Application
Biodiesel Production currently accounts for approximately 35–40 percent of market demand, while Renewable Diesel Production represents around 20–25 percent as investments in advanced biofuel technologies expand. Sustainable Aviation Fuel remains an emerging but rapidly developing segment with approximately 10–15 percent share, supported by growing aviation decarbonization initiatives. Oleochemicals, Soaps and Detergents, and other industrial applications collectively account for approximately 25–30 percent of utilization.
By Collection Method
Direct Commercial Collection dominates the Chinese market with approximately 50–55 percent share, supported by relationships with restaurants, hotels, and institutional kitchens. Third-Party Waste Aggregators account for around 30–35 percent, particularly in densely populated urban regions. Municipal Collection Systems contribute approximately 8–10 percent, while Household Drop-off and Recycling Programs represent below 5 percent of recovered volumes, highlighting significant opportunities for future development.
